      Velaryon, in my next video I'll be comparing the 981 Cayman S PDK with the Boxster S manual (from this video) so keep an eye out for it. In summary the PDK is a sensational box to use at those speeds, the lightning fast changes, either in auto or manual mode, with the Sport Design steering wheel paddles is involving and intoxicating. The 981 Manual box gears are quite long, so I'd say that for instant response the PDK will alway win. HOWEVER, I really believe that the fact that you are changing the gear, feeding the clutch, multiplies the level of involvement, so even though it is less efficient, takes longer than the PDK, the manual is the one you feel engaged to drive on a back road. The PDK is almost too slick! Hope this helps, maybe my video (which is just awaiting my editing) will help expand on this. Cheers and thanks for watching! Raj

    What about the steering? Hydraulic vs Electric?

    • @MRSPORTSCARSPORSCHE
      @MRSPORTSCARSPORSCHE  5 місяців тому

      Both are fantastic, just different. Hydraulic is more direct translation to exactly what is under the wheels, the electric definitely filters out some of the roughness (much needed in the UK on our roads at the moment) while still telling you what you need to know so that it doesn't feel wooly or vague. Thanks, Raj

    Great video! Thanks! On the gear lever seems that the 981’s lever is positioned slightly higher? Is that true and which gear lever feels better ? Thanks

    • @MRSPORTSCARSPORSCHE
      @MRSPORTSCARSPORSCHE  4 роки тому +3

      Thanks Guillaume, really appreciate your kind words. The 981 gear lever is indeed positioned quite a bit higher than the 987 Gen 1 & Gen 2 cars. Personally I prefer the positioning of the 987.2 gear stick. I would actually look at getting a shorter gear stick for the 981 to lower the hand position slightly. Also the gear change on the 981 without the short shift kit (easy to retrofit) feels slightly sloppy vs the 987.2, but again this is an easy fix. Pleased you found the video and enjoyed it. Raj
